Choosing the Best Industrial Parts: A Guide to Ensuring Efficiency and Reliability

In the world of industrial operations, the selection of the right parts is not just a matter of maintenanceit’s a critical factor in ensuring efficiency, safety, and long-term cost savings. Whether it’s for manufacturing equipment, heavy machinery, or automation systems, choosing high-quality and compatible industrial parts can make the difference between smooth operations and frequent downtimes. With the wide variety of options available in the market, it’s essential to make informed decisions based on specific operational requirements, budget considerations, and reliability expectations.

The first and perhaps most fundamental aspect of choosing industrial parts is understanding the exact requirements of the machinery or system in which the part will be used. Industrial systems often have precise specifications, and even minor deviations in size, material, or compatibility can lead to significant performance issues. Reading the manufacturer’s manual, consulting with engineers, and assessing the operational demands of the equipment are all vital steps in this process. A well-matched part not only improves performance but also helps extend the life of the machinery.

Quality should be at the forefront when selecting industrial parts. Cheaper, low-quality components may seem cost-effective initially, but they often result in increased wear and tear, higher maintenance costs, and unplanned downtime. Trusted brands and certified suppliers typically provide better assurance in terms of material quality, manufacturing standards, and after-sale support. Looking for certifications such as ISO or OEM compliance can also help ensure that the parts meet industry standards for durability and performance.

Another important factor to consider is the source of the parts. Working with reputable suppliers or distributors can greatly reduce the risk of receiving counterfeit or substandard components. Reliable vendors often offer warranty coverage, technical support, and detailed documentation that can aid in installation and maintenance. Additionally, establishing long-term relationships with trusted suppliers can provide benefits like priority service, better pricing, and faster deliveryadvantages that are particularly valuable during urgent repair situations.

Technology also plays a growing role in the industrial parts selection process. With advancements in digital inventory management and predictive maintenance, many companies are now using data-driven systems to monitor the condition of their equipment and anticipate parts replacement needs before failures occur. Integrating these technologies into your maintenance strategy can help you make smarter decisions about when and what parts to purchase, leading to improved uptime and resource management.

Lastly, it’s important to consider the total lifecycle cost of the parts rather than focusing solely on the purchase price. This includes not only the cost of the part itself but also its expected lifespan, maintenance requirements, and potential impact on overall equipment efficiency. Investing in high-performance parts may cost more upfront, but they can significantly lower operational costs in the long run by reducing the frequency of replacements and avoiding production losses due to equipment failure.

In conclusion, choosing the best industrial parts is a strategic decision that impacts the entire operation of an industrial facility. By prioritizing compatibility, quality, reliability, and supplier credibility, businesses can ensure that their equipment runs smoothly and efficientlyultimately leading to better performance, reduced downtime, and greater profitability.

Outdoor Spray Foam Insulation: 5 Key Benefits for Your Home

When it comes to improving energy efficiency and protecting your home from the elements, outdoor spray foam insulation stands out as a top-tier solution. Unlike traditional insulation methods, spray foam expands upon application, filling every crack and gap, creating a strong and seamless barrier. Whether you’re insulating a new build or retrofitting an existing structure, here are five key reasons to consider outdoor spray foam insulation.

1. Superior Air and Moisture Barrier
Spray foam insulation excels at sealing off your home from air leaks and moisture intrusion. When applied to the exterior of a homeespecially in areas like rooflines, foundations, or wall cavitiesit forms an airtight seal that traditional insulation can’t match. This helps prevent drafts, moisture buildup, and even the growth of mold or mildew. In wetter or colder climates, this moisture barrier is especially critical for protecting the structural integrity of your home.

2. Boosts Energy Efficiency
One of the main draws of outdoor spray foam insulation is its outstanding thermal resistance, often measured by a high R-value. By creating a tight seal, spray foam minimizes the amount of heated or cooled air that escapes your home. This significantly reduces your heating and cooling costs over time.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, homeowners can save up to 20{2ce3eea5861f8428a14533b835a0da7f7a1989a90c075ae2e1dd29378547d2ae} on heating and cooling bills by properly insulating their homesand spray foam can help you get there.

3. Increases Structural Strength
Closed-cell spray foam, in particular, adds structural integrity to your home. When applied to exterior walls, it hardens and bonds with surfaces to create a rigid, durable layer. This reinforcement can improve the resistance of walls to high winds and shifting soil, which is especially beneficial in areas prone to hurricanes, earthquakes, or other natural stressors.

4. Long-Lasting Performance
Unlike fiberglass or cellulose, spray foam doesn’t sag, settle, or degrade over time. It maintains its shape and insulating properties for decades with little to no maintenance. This long-term durability makes it a smart investment for homeowners looking for a “set it and forget it” insulation solution. Additionally, because spray foam resists water and pests, it contributes to the long-term health of your home’s building envelope.

5. Eco-Friendly Options Available
Many modern spray foam products are now made with environmentally conscious formulassome even using plant-based oils or recycled materials. Plus, by reducing your home’s energy consumption, you’re also decreasing your overall carbon footprint. When installed properly, outdoor spray foam insulation can contribute toward energy certifications like LEED and Energy Star.

QuickBooks Accountant is a comprehensive accounting software tailored specifically for accounting professionals, bookkeepers, and accounting firms. Developed by Intuit, QuickBooks Accountant provides powerful tools to manage client accounts efficiently, streamline financial processes, and ensure accuracy in financial reporting. Its user-friendly interface combined with advanced features makes it an essential resource for accountants who need to handle multiple clients and complex financial data with ease. One of the primary advantages of QuickBooks Accountant is its ability to facilitate seamless client collaboration.

Accountants can access multiple client files within a single platform, reducing the need to switch between different software or systems. This centralized approach not only saves time but also enhances accuracy, as accountants can quickly review, adjust, and finalize financial statements. Additionally, QuickBooks Accountant offers features like batch adjustments, which allow users to make changes to multiple transactions simultaneously, saving significant time during tax season or audits. The software also includes tools for detailed reporting and analysis, enabling accountants to generate customized reports that provide insights into a client’s financial health, cash flow, and profitability.

These reports are vital for advising clients and making informed financial decisions. Another noteworthy feature is the ability to prepare and file tax returns directly from the platform, streamlining the tax preparation process. QuickBooks Accountant integrates with various tax software, facilitating a smooth transfer of data and reducing the risk of errors. This integration is particularly beneficial during tax season, as it helps accountants meet deadlines efficiently. Furthermore, QuickBooks Accountant offers extensive training resources, including tutorials, webinars, and dedicated customer support, ensuring users can maximize the software’s potential. Security is also a top priority; the platform employs robust encryption and user access controls to protect sensitive financial data.

Multi-user access and permission settings enable accountants to collaborate securely with colleagues or clients while maintaining control over sensitive information. The software continually evolves, with updates that incorporate new features, compliance requirements, and industry standards, keeping accountants ahead in a rapidly changing financial landscape. Overall, QuickBooks Accountant is an indispensable tool for accounting professionals aiming to deliver high-quality service to their clients. Its combination of efficiency, accuracy, and collaboration capabilities makes it a preferred choice for managing diverse accounting tasksfrom bookkeeping and payroll to financial reporting and tax preparation. By leveraging its advanced features, accountants can focus more on strategic advisory roles rather than getting bogged down in manual data entry or administrative tasks.

In conclusion, QuickBooks Accountant stands out as a robust, reliable, and user-centric platform that empowers accounting professionals to operate more effectively, serve their clients better, and stay compliant with industry standards. Its integration capabilities, comprehensive tools, and ongoing support make it a valuable asset in the modern accounting landscape, helping professionals navigate complex financial environments with confidence and ease.

Adhesion failures

Adhesion failures are a significant concern across various industries and applications, impacting the durability, performance, and safety of products and structures. These failures occur when two materials or surfaces that are intended to bond together lose their adhesion, resulting in separation, delamination, or a breakdown of the bonded interface. Understanding the underlying causes, types, and preventive measures of adhesion failures is critical to maintaining the integrity of bonded systems, whether in aerospace, automotive, construction, electronics, biomedical devices, or everyday items.
Causes of Adhesion Failures
Several factors contribute to adhesion failures, and often, multiple issues combine to weaken the bond:
1. Surface Contamination: Dirt, oils, grease, moisture, or chemical residues on surfaces prevent proper contact and adhesion. For example, if a metal surface is not thoroughly cleaned before applying adhesive, contaminants can create a physical barrier, inhibiting bonding.
2. Inadequate Surface Preparation: Proper surface roughness and cleanliness are essential for optimal adhesion. Smooth, unprimed surfaces may not provide enough mechanical interlocking, reducing bond strength.
3. Material Incompatibility: Not all adhesives are suitable for all substrates. Chemical incompatibility can lead to poor bonding. For instance, a polymer adhesive may not adhere well to certain plastics without proper surface treatment.
4. Environmental Conditions: Temperature, humidity, and exposure to chemicals during application or curing can influence adhesion. Excessive moisture or fluctuating temperatures can weaken the bond over time.
5. Incorrect Application Procedures: Applying adhesives with improper techniques, such as insufficient curing time or incorrect curing temperature, can result in weak bonds.
6. Mechanical Stress and Fatigue: Over time, repeated loading, impact, or vibration can induce stress at the bonded interface, leading to fatigue and eventual failure.
7. Aging and Degradation: Exposure to UV radiation, chemicals, or thermal cycling can degrade adhesive materials or substrate surfaces, reducing adhesion over time.
Types of Adhesion Failures
Adhesion failures can be classified based on where the failure occurs within the bonded system:
Adhesive Failure: This occurs at the interface between the adhesive and substrate. It indicates poor bonding at the surface, often due to surface contamination or inadequate surface preparation.
Cohesive Failure: The failure occurs within the adhesive layer itself. This suggests that the adhesive’s internal strength was exceeded, which could be due to insufficient adhesive formulation or excessive stress.
Mixed Failure: A combination of adhesive and cohesive failures, often indicating complex issues with surface preparation, adhesive strength, or loading conditions.
Detecting and Diagnosing Adhesion Failures
Identifying the root cause of adhesion failures involves various diagnostic techniques:
Visual Inspection: Look for signs of peeling, blistering, or delamination.
Surface Analysis: Use tools like scanning electron microscopy (SEM), Fourier-transform infrared spectroscopy (FTIR), or contact angle measurements to analyze surface contamination and roughness.
Mechanical Testing: Conduct shear, peel, or tensile tests to measure bond strength.
Chemical Analysis: Assess chemical compatibility between adhesive and substrate.
Conclusion
Adhesion failures represent a complex interplay of surface chemistry, material compatibility, environmental factors, and application techniques. Addressing these challenges involves understanding the causes, employing proper surface preparation, selecting suitable adhesives, and ensuring optimal application procedures. Advances in adhesive technology, surface treatment methods, and testing techniques continue to improve the reliability of bonded systems. Recognizing the potential for adhesion failure and proactively designing to mitigate it are essential for ensuring the long-term durability and safety of bonded materials across various industries. Whether in aerospace, automotive, electronics, or construction, diligent attention to adhesion principles can significantly reduce the risk of failure and extend the life of bonded assemblies.
